Energy Usage Of Window Air Conditioner. On average, a window ac unit uses around 1000 watts while operating, though the energy usage can vary depending on the unit's size, model,. Window air conditioners are rated by their cooling capacity, typically between 5,000 btu and 12,000 btu. Running a window air conditioner efficiently is crucial for maintaining a comfortable indoor environment, reducing energy consumption, and lowering energy costs. Climate, home size, and seer rating can all make a big difference. It takes 2,365 kwh of electricity per year to cool an average home in the u.s., according to an energysage analysis of a department of energy building database.
